A woman and her two children were admitted to the Molina Orosa Hospital this Tuesday with stab wounds, as confirmed to La Voz by the Security and Emergency Coordinating Center. The Judicial Police unit of the Costa Teguise Civil Guard has already launched an investigation into what happened, although sources close to the case suggest that the woman may have self-injured.
The events took place in a house in Arrieta, where the Canary Islands Emergency Service had to send ambulances and healthcare personnel to attend to the woman and her children, who are minors. All of them had stab wounds and this Wednesday they remained hospitalized. In the case of the children, they are apparently only under observation and their injuries are not serious.
In addition to the woman and the two minors, some sources indicate that there may have been other family members in the house when the events occurred. Now, the Haría City Council is waiting to know the evolution of the investigation to see if its intervention with the minors is necessary, once they are discharged from the hospital.
